Overview

Field Value
Gene ID LotjaGi2g1v0312400
Transcript ID LotjaGi2g1v0312400.1
Related isoforms 1
Lotus japonicus genome version Gifu v1.2
Description Serine/threonine-protein phosphatase; TAIR: AT1G10430.1 protein phosphatase 2A-2; Swiss-Prot: sp|Q9ZSE4|PP2A_HEVBR Serine/threonine-protein phosphatase PP2A catalytic subunit; TrEMBL-Plants: tr|V7CKW4|V7CKW4_PHAVU Serine/threonine-protein phosphatase; Found in the gene: LotjaGi2g1v0312400
Working Lj name n.a.
